Other Facts: -Brother of pro wrestler Crisstopher Crow
-Wrestled under a mask as Spawn Johnson. He confirmed that he was under that mask by donning the mask and adopting the persona during a match against Colton Kinnamon on March 24, 2024. While competing as Spawn Johnson, he was billed from Hell.
-Graduated from Newcastle High School in Newcastle, OK
-Originally billed from Elm Street
-Defeated Nathaniel Blade in his debut match
-Former member of TKI
-Former member of The Clockwork Clique
-Former member of Nemesis
-Former member of The Franchise Players
-Former member of The Payroll
-Former member of Change
-Shortest reigning SWCW Champion in the company's history
-With Skylar Slice, they became the 1st Intergender tag team champions in Oklahoma history when they won the CPW Tag Team Titles on January 20, 2023
-Only male ASP Grand Slam Champion (Held the Heavyweight, Tag Team, Mid-American, 5-Star and All-Time Titles)
-Only documented wrestler to hold 5 different titles in 4 different Oklahoma-based companies simultaneously
